Product Overview

Osmosis
Osmosis

Description: Osmosis is an open-source automation tool for migrating data between databases. It can extract, load, transform, and synchronize data using JSON, CSV, XML, etc. Useful for ETL jobs and database migrations.

Type: software

Pricing: Open Source

Vespucci
Vespucci

Description: Vespucci is an open-source, cross-platform IDE and editor for building Knowledge Graphs. It allows users to create, edit, and publish semantic data as Linked Data or RDF graphs. Key features include graph visualization, SPARQL querying, export to common RDF formats, and integration with data sources and triple stores.

Type: software

Pricing: Open Source
